Shelton Vineyards

Shelton Vineyards is the largest family-owned estate winery in North Carolina. Located in the Yadkin Valley near Dobson and Mt. Airy, NC, the 383-acre estate has nearly 200 acres of premium vinifera grapes and offers daily tours and tastings at its winery
